Strengths That Make Suyou a Top-Tier Hero
One of Suyou’s greatest strengths is his remarkable mobility. His abilities allow him to reposition rapidly, chase fleeing opponents, and escape dangerous situations with relative ease. This mobility makes him difficult to predict and even harder to catch, especially when controlled by experienced players.
Another significant advantage is his impressive burst damage. Suyou can eliminate fragile heroes within seconds if he successfully executes his combo. Enemy marksmen and mages are particularly vulnerable because they often lack the durability needed to survive his explosive attacks.
Suyou also possesses excellent versatility. He is equally effective during small skirmishes, jungle invasions, objective contests, and full-scale team fights. This adaptability ensures he remains valuable throughout every phase of the game.
His fast jungle clear speed further increases his effectiveness. Efficient farming allows him to gain level and gold advantages earlier than many opposing junglers, creating opportunities to snowball the game before enemies can recover.
Finally, Suyou rewards intelligent gameplay. Players who maintain excellent map awareness and carefully choose their engagements often achieve far better results than those who rely purely on mechanical skill.
Weaknesses Every Player Should Know
Despite his impressive strengths, Suyou has several weaknesses that require careful management.
His relatively low durability means positioning is critical. Diving into multiple opponents without a clear escape route almost always results in elimination.
Crowd-control effects are another major threat. Stuns, knock-ups, suppressions, and immobilizing abilities can completely interrupt his combos, leaving him vulnerable before he has the opportunity to retreat.
Suyou also depends heavily on cooldown management. Missing important abilities drastically reduces both his damage output and mobility, making him significantly less effective until those skills become available again.
He is also vulnerable when falling behind economically. Without sufficient items, his burst damage becomes much less threatening, making it difficult to eliminate priority targets.
Understanding these limitations is essential for anyone hoping to consistently perform well with Suyou.

Best Battle Spell
Retribution is unquestionably the preferred battle spell when playing Suyou as the Jungler.
It accelerates farming speed, improves objective control, and provides additional flexibility during jungle contests.
If playing in the EXP Lane, Flicker becomes an excellent alternative due to its offensive and defensive versatility.
Execute can occasionally serve aggressive side-lane strategies by helping secure difficult eliminations against durable opponents.
Choosing the correct battle spell ultimately depends on the assigned role and team composition.

Common Mistakes Players Should Avoid
Many Suyou players become overly aggressive after securing an early advantage. While confidence is beneficial, unnecessary tower dives and reckless jungle invasions frequently throw away winning positions.
Ignoring vision also creates avoidable deaths. Entering dark jungle areas without information often results in ambushes by coordinated opponents.
Another common mistake involves targeting tanks instead of fragile carries. Although tanks may appear easier to reach, eliminating enemy damage dealers usually provides far greater value.
Some players also neglect farming after successful kills. Maintaining a consistent gold advantage remains essential throughout the entire match.
Finally, failing to adapt item builds according to enemy defenses significantly reduces Suyou’s overall effectiveness during the late game.
